原文:C#异常处理-多重catch块

有时候只使用一个异常处理不完全解决程序中出现的异常,需要多个异常处理,这就需要多重catch来实现。 一段代码可能会生成多个异常当引发异常时,会按顺序来查看每个 catch 语句,并执行第一个类型与异常类型匹配的语句执行其中的一条 catch 语句之后,其他的 catch 语句将被忽略。 多重catch语法如下: try 正常程序处理语句 catch ArrayIndexOutOfBoundsEx ...

2012-06-28 09:12 0 3609 推荐指数:

查看详情

C++异常处理(try和catch

我们通常希望自己编写的程序能够在异常的情况下也能作出相应的处理,而不至于程序莫名其妙地中断或者中止运行了。在设计程序时应充分考虑各种异常情况,并加以处理。 在C++中,一个函数能够检测出异常并且将异常返回,这种机制称为抛出异常。当抛出异常后,函数调用者捕获到该异常,并对该异常进行处理,我们称之为 ...

Sat Apr 21 21:40:00 CST 2018 0 35801
【又长见识了】C#异常处理,try、catch、finally、throw

     异常处理:程序在运行过程中,发生错误会导致程序退出,这种错误,就叫做异常处理这种错误,就叫做异常处理。   1、轻描淡写Try、Catch、Finally、throw用法   在异常处理中,首先需要对可能发生异常的语句进行异常捕捉,try就是用于预测可能出现的异常。捕获异常 ...

Sat Aug 16 01:22:00 CST 2014 0 5174
C#异常处理机制(try...catch...finally)

what? 在 C# 语言中异常异常处理语句包括三种形式,即 try catch、try finally、try catch finally。在上述三种异常处理的形式中所用到关键字其含义如下: try:一个 try 标识了一个将被激活的特定的异常的代码。后跟一个或多个 catch ...

Sun Oct 11 17:34:00 CST 2020 0 581
22 C#中的异常处理入门 try catch throw

软件运行过程中,如果出现了软件正常运行不应该出现的情况,软件就出现了异常。这时候我们需要去处理这些异常。或者让程序终止,避免出现更严重的错误。或者提示用户进行某些更改让程序可以继续运行下去。 C#编程语言本身就为我们提供了这种异常处理机制。 C# 中的异常是对程序运行时出现的特殊情况的一种响应 ...

Tue Jul 05 17:32:00 CST 2016 0 22024
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M